This series was started back in the early 1960s and takes the form of a small format, soft cover booklet with 12 or more pages.  Illustrations are generally black & white photographs (though some later ones had some colour) with two or more pages of colour profiles.  In addition summaries of aircraft specification, performance and armament are detailed.  Many of these booklets can still be a useful reference tool and are highly sought after little books are an invaluable resource for aviation historians, modellers and collectors alike.
